Conflicts: src/main/php/classes/tubepress/api/const/event/EventNames.php src/main/php/classes/tubepress/api/ioc/ContainerBuilderInterface.php src/main/php/classes/tubepress/api/ioc/ContainerInterface.php
… if sys temp directory is not available
… to core add-on.
ApiGen likes their docblocks to look as follows: @param [type] [desc] All the documentation was set up as: @param [type] [varname] [desc] Changed everything to be in first type, as that's what we're using. ApiGen is smart enough to determine the varname from the function itself. Also added a bunch of `<var>varname</var>` to the **Argument** descriptors. I realized that there's no good way to list the arguments next to constants, but we are able to write raw html into the docblocks. This makes the API docs significantly more readable. Also added some text to the eventinterface header. Also added a few todos where either (1) there's no docs or (2) the docs expose ehough_* methods which we don't want people to see.